Output efed96a8345f38434e25fefd121cbfccd17adb543bff48026233f49655963247:40
- value
- 1505473
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b7efa9ed4819b2b893ccfc42d637c5da89c5a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TuFCZE2GjAUCP4odbuR534UTiZoFAbap
- transaction
- efed96a8345f38434e25fefd121cbfccd17adb543bff48026233f49655963247